Job Description
Job description

We are seeking a Welder who will be responsible for performing high-quality weld repair works on
crusher rotors and heavy rotating equipment using approved welding procedures.
Candidate must be skilled in GMAW and SMAW processes, multi-pass welding, all
welding positions, and heat control requirements to ensure structural integrity
and equipment reliability.

Responsibilities:
• Perform weld repair of crusher rotors and heavy rotating equipment components.
• Execute groove and fillet welds in all positions as per approved WPS.
• Carry out multi-pass welding using GMAW root and SMAW fill/cap methods.
• Maintain required preheat and interpass temperatures during welding.
• Inspect weld quality and coordinate with QA/QC for testing requirements.
• Ensure proper grinding, preparation, fit-up, and final finishing.
• Follow all workshop/site safety procedures and PPE requirements.
• Maintain welding tools, machines, and consumables in safe working condition.

Requirements
• Valid ASME Section IX Welding Qualification Test (WQT) mandatory.
• Qualified in GMAW + SMAW welding processes.
• Proven experience with:
• ER80S-Ni2 (1.6 mm) – GMAW
• E8018-C1 (3.2 mm) – SMAW
• Qualified for all positions (groove & fillet welding).
• Experience in multi-pass welding (GMAW root + SMAW fill/cap).
• Familiar with Preheat 120°C – 150°C and interpass temperature control.
• Minimum 5+ years of experience in heavy equipment / rotating equipment repair.
• Ability to read WPS, follow welding procedures, and maintain quality standards.
